**Specialty Centers and Programs:**
Beyond general cardiology departments, some hospitals may have specialized centers or programs focusing on hypertension management. These programs often involve a team of specialists, including cardiologists, nephrologists (kidney specialists, as kidney disease is often linked to hypertension), endocrinologists (hormone specialists), and registered dietitians. These programs can provide comprehensive care, including lifestyle modifications, medication management, and patient education.

**ER Wait Times and Emergency Care:**
In the event of a hypertensive crisis, rapid access to emergency care is crucial. ER wait times can vary depending on the hospital and the time of day. Patients should familiarize themselves with the ER wait times of hospitals in their area and know which hospitals are best equipped to handle hypertensive emergencies.
